Recently, some problems have been found in the definition of the partialderivative in the case of the presence of both explicit and implicit functionaldependencies in the classical analysis. In this talk we investigate theinfluence of this observation on the quantum mechanics and classical/quantumfield theory. Surprisingly, some commutators of the coordinate-dependentoperators are not equal to zero. Therefore, we try to provide mathematicalfoundations to the modern non-commutative theories. We also indicate possibleapplications in the Dirac-like theories.
